CVE-2024-42157

Key-material exposure via failed userspace copy

Published Jul 30, 2024 · Updated May 11, 2026

Information disclosure in the Linux s390 protected-key API allows local users to expose cryptographic key material retained on the kernel stack. In pkey_unlocked_ioctl, failed copy_to_user calls for PKEY_CLR2SECK and PKEY_CLR2PROTK return before memzero_explicit erases the kcs or kcp structure. Exploitation requires high-privileged local access on an s390 system and a failed userspace copy; the reported consequence is limited to confidentiality.
